The Imposing Basilica of Our Lady of the Assumption
Basilica refers to type of building, which is usually a Christian church and typically rectangular with a central nave and aisles. It features a slightly raised platform followed by an apse at one or both the ends.Basilica of Our Lady of the Assumption, also commonly known as St. Mary's Church, Secunderabad is a minor basilica, situated in the locality of Secunderabad, India. The decree which designated this church as a basilica was issued in the year 2008.
St. Mary’s Basilica is an imposing landmark, as well as a magnificent sight on the Sarojini Devi Road in Secunderabad.The St.Mary's Church is the oldest Roman Catholic Churches in the city. This fascinating Church was built in Indo-Gothic style and was sanctified in the year 1850 by Father Daniel Murphy along with Bishop Carew. It was formerly called the Cathedral of the Archdiocese of Hyderabad.
The church is dedicated to the Blessed Virgin Mary. It was principal Church of the Vicariate of Hyderabad. It is one of the famous Churches in the twin cities of Hyderabad and Secunderabad, and also one of the biggest parishes in the Archdiocese of Hyderabad which consists of various linguistic groups such as Anglo Indian, Telugu, English, Tamil, Malayalam, Konkani with more than 4500 Parishioners.
It is praised for both its architectural excellence and incredible history. In the days when the church was the Vicariate of Hyderabad, it was widely known as St. Mary's Cathedral. The most striking features of this church are its curved arches and buttress. This unique church has several side altars devoted to the saints. It has four bells, which was brought all the way from Italy in the year 1901.
